Avant Homes Scotland has received planning permission for a new £31m residential development in Tranent, East Lothian.

The Thistle Meadows scheme will comprise 92 three-, four- and five-bedroom family homes, including 10 of Avant Homes’ energy efficient houses.

Work is scheduled to start on site in May and it is anticipated that the first properties will be released for sale in June with the first residents moving into their new homes in February 2025.
